ok. so polar express. i think i caught it one month too early. lol. one thing about the show was that the people looked really lifeless. i know it's an animation and all but somehow something was missing.. they were all too wooden. and the facial expressions were just off. actually the whole show was like an elaborate amusement park ride, what with all the pseudo-rollercoaster scenes and all. plus the city at the north pole reminded me way too much of a disneyland ride.. i almost expected the elves to start singing it's a small world after all.

oh and the whole thing was more of a nightmare than a dream. creepy puppets with broken noses surrounding yu and singing freaky songs?? and the throng of elves chanting yu better watch out yu better not cry santa claus is coming to town was totally giving me the creeps. plus the deserted factory with old records of christmas carols playing on the public announcement system. geez.

and i kept feeling that they were implying more than just believing in santa.. maybe i was reading too much into it, but it felt like they were talking about something else. hmm.
